Wind Noise Reduction Performance
The mini alto 410 grey fur replacement achieves up to 40dB of wind noise reduction when properly fitted to the Mini-ALTO 410 windshield frame. This performance specification matches the effectiveness of many larger windshield systems, demonstrating the acoustic engineering efficiency of the compact Mini-ALTO design. The reduction characteristics remain consistent across typical field recording wind conditions, from light breeze to moderate wind environments.
Professional field recordists rely on this level of wind protection to maintain usable audio in exterior recording scenarios. The 40dB reduction capability ensures that wind noise does not compromise dialogue clarity or ambient sound recording quality during outdoor production work.

Compatible Microphone Systems
This replacement windcover fits the Mini-ALTO 410 size classification, compatible with several professional microphone models. The Audio-Technica AT8035, BP28, BP4027, and BP4071 microphones utilize the Mini-ALTO 410 windshield system. Additional compatibility includes the Neumann KMR 82 i, Sennheiser MKH70, and Shure VP89M microphones when configured with Mini-ALTO 410 mounting hardware.
Each compatible microphone benefits from the standardized Mini-ALTO 410 form factor, ensuring consistent wind protection performance across different capsule designs and polar patterns.
